Everything looks green at Eco Expo 2009
April 16, 2009
Lake Saint Louis
It’s been called “the region’s premier green event” and it’s FREE.
On April 18 and 19 from 9:30 a.m. to 5:30 p.m., the St. Louis Science Center will host Eco Expo 2009.
There will be activities for kids; organic food and wine sampling; eco-friendly interactive exhibits; product demonstrations and more.
It’s a carbon-neutral event! AmerenUE’s Pure Power Program will provide Renewable Energy Certificates equal to 100% of the electricity used at the Eco Expo. According to the Eco Expo’s website, the expo’s support of clean energy will prevent 84,715 pounds of carbon dioxide from entering the atmosphere, which has the same environmental benefit as taking seven cars off the road for one year.
